Title loans without inspection, as the name suggests, are a type of secured loan where a borrower can access capital by using their vehicle’s (usually a car) title as collateral. The key feature that sets it apart is the absence of a comprehensive vehicle inspection process typically required by traditional lenders. Instead, borrowers provide their vehicle’s title, and the lender issues the loan based on the vehicle’s estimated value, without physically examining it in detail.

One of the most significant criticisms of title loans without inspection is the potential for high-interest rates, which can trap borrowers in cycles of debt. The absence of a thorough vehicle inspection may lead to lenders offering loans based on conservative vehicle valuations, resulting in lower loan amounts and higher interest rates compared to traditional loans. Borrowers might find it challenging to repay these loans on time, leading to extended periods of financial strain.
Transparency is another critical issue in the title loan industry. Some lenders employ complex fee structures with hidden costs, making it difficult for borrowers to fully understand the total price of borrowing. These fees can include processing charges, early repayment penalties, and documentation fees, all of which contribute to higher overall costs. Enhancing transparency through clear disclosure practices is essential to protecting borrowers’ rights.

Q: How do title loans without inspection differ from traditional car loans?
A: Traditional car loans typically require a thorough inspection of the vehicle to assess its value and determine loan eligibility. In contrast, title loans without inspection rely on the vehicle’s title as collateral and omit the detailed inspection process, making them faster and more convenient for borrowers.
Q: Are there any risks associated with taking out a title loan without inspection?
A: Yes, while these loans offer convenience, they also carry risks. High-interest rates, hidden fees, and the potential for trapping borrowers in debt are significant concerns. It’s crucial to thoroughly understand the terms and conditions before agreeing to such a loan.
Q: Who can apply for a title loan without inspection?
A: Eligibility criteria vary by lender, but generally, borrowers need to be at least 18 years old, have a valid driver’s license, and own a vehicle with a clear title. Some lenders may also consider individuals with poor credit history or limited credit checks.
Q: How quickly can I get the funds from a title loan without inspection?
A: The processing time can vary, but these loans are designed to be swift. After completing an online application and providing necessary documents, borrowers can often receive their funds within a few business days, sometimes even faster.
Q: Can I pay off my title loan early without penalties?
A: Many lenders offer the option to repay the loan early without incurring additional fees or penalties. However, it’s essential to confirm this with your lender as some may charge prepayment fees. Early repayment can help borrowers save on interest and exit the loan faster.
